Output 520637de5cc3c74bca62990ceea7828aea6e54afa99b4c1903d4fa7645b65cc2:1

value
16059
script pubkey
OP_0 OP_PUSHBYTES_20 1839da449e93861a2063dd564dc6b8ee88586309
address
bc1qrqua53y7jwrp5grrm4tym34ca6y9sccf973lwx
transaction
520637de5cc3c74bca62990ceea7828aea6e54afa99b4c1903d4fa7645b65cc2
confirmations
41937
spent
true